Actually, my point was that you need alot more than what's in the tool kit -- in addition to the tool kit, I keep with me a real ratchet with (6mm head head, 10mm, 13mm, 15mm, 17mm, 19mm sockets and 24mm deep), 3inch extension, wrenches (10mm, 13mm, 15mm, 17mm), tire gauge, duct tape, electrical tape, bag of spare bolts and a flashlight. And they've come in handy!
